May 2025 - Apr 2026Maxwell Road area has the 13th highest crime rate of 81 local areas in Borehamwood Brookmeadow , and the 28th highest crime rate of 317 local areas in Hertsmere .
Crime levels at this postcode are much higher than in the adjoining streets, suggesting that most neighbouring areas are relatively safer than this one.
The overall crime rate in the area around Maxwell Road (WD6 1FS) in the last 12 months was 189.3 per 1,000 residents and was 16.5% higher than the Borehamwood Brookmeadow average (162.5 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 26 offences recorded. The least common crime was Other crime with 1 case , down -50.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Possession of weapons 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Other crime ( -50.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 32 (≈ 90.4 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-3.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-55.2%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Maxwell Road (WD6 1FS),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Petrol Station, where police recorded 57 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Shenley Road (23 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
